Hongling Lan is a scholar working on Water Science and Technology, Biomedical Engineering and Mechanical Engineering. According to data from OpenAlex, Hongling Lan has authored 9 papers receiving a total of 435 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Water Science and Technology, 8 papers in Biomedical Engineering and 4 papers in Mechanical Engineering. Recurrent topics in Hongling Lan's work include Membrane Separation Technologies (9 papers), Membrane-based Ion Separation Techniques (6 papers) and Membrane Separation and Gas Transport (3 papers). Hongling Lan is often cited by papers focused on Membrane Separation Technologies (9 papers), Membrane-based Ion Separation Techniques (6 papers) and Membrane Separation and Gas Transport (3 papers). Hongling Lan collaborates with scholars based in China. Hongling Lan's co-authors include Q. Jason Niu, Chi Jiang, Zhe Zhai, Ming Wang, Kuo Chen, Wenjing Dong, Na Zhao, Yingfei Hou, Ming Wang and Pengfei Li and has published in prestigious journals such as Journal of Materials Chemistry A, Journal of Membrane Science and Desalination.
